Now that you've spun up your Preview Site, you'll want to turn your attention to the design elements of your website. This guide helps you align your clinic’s visual branding, mainly your colour palette, so Jane Websites reflects your clinic's identity. 

 

Before you start

You'll need to have Admin access to have access to your Design settings. You'll also want to make sure you have your brand’s primary and secondary colour codes (hex values). 

 


How to Style Your Site with Colours

You'll want to configure your site's brand colours. If Jane Websites is integrated with Jane, your clinic's branding colours will sync automatically. Otherwise, you’ll need to update them manually.
 

Update Your Colours
You’ll update your site’s colour scheme so it visually matches your brand.

  1. If your Jane account is integrated with your Jane Websites website, take a look at our guide on How to set the colours on your website (Jane Integration).
  2. If you're looking to manually make changes to your clinic's brand colours, dive into our guide on How to manually change your website colours.

Note

If your Jane Websites website is integrated with Jane, you can turn off your theme sync from Admin > Settings > Jane Integration so that your Jane colours and Jane Websites colours remain separate.
